Meaning: The name "Crew" means "a group of people working together."

The name "Crew" is a distinctive and modern choice, predominantly given to males. It is derived from the English word "crew," which originally referred to a group of people working together. This name conveys a sense of camaraderie and teamwork, attributes that are often valued in group settings. In recent times, the name Crew has gained recognition through various cultural influences, including its use by notable figures in the entertainment industry. The name's contemporary appeal and straightforward sound have contributed to its growing popularity. It carries a modern and fresh vibe, making it a favored choice among parents seeking a unique yet meaningful name for their child.
